Dynamic Addressing
A method where a network device is assigned an IP address automatically from a pool of addresses, and the address can change over time.
Protocol Suite
A collection of protocols that work together to provide comprehensive network communication services.
Packet Switching
A method of grouping data transmitted over a digital network into packets, which are then routed independently to the destination, allowing for efficient use of network resources.
16-Bit Numbers
Numerical values represented using 16 binary digits, allowing for a range of values from 0 to 65,535 in unsigned form or −32,768 to 32,767 in signed form.
